    I found in the google maps help page (in Norwegian) that you must use dot and not comma for coordinates, guess that's a global way. This link works fine, also the link you shared: https://www.google.com/maps/search/59.916333,10.7235603

    I google translated the topic for help coordinates: "Use dot as decimal point, not comma. Error: 41,40338, 2,17403. Correct: 41.40338, 2.17403."
